Output c66244b28f1454439661ef4c89bcc6cc801c7c954e595470e2d95e17777cee8a:1

value
79857
script pubkey
OP_0 OP_PUSHBYTES_32 3dcf46b1e17658142113907bffe6fde37f7ea145904f58a7d38167ba8c18d166
address
bc1q8h85dv0pwevpgggnjpallehaudlhag29jp843f7ns9nm4rqc69nqyra0cw
transaction
c66244b28f1454439661ef4c89bcc6cc801c7c954e595470e2d95e17777cee8a
confirmations
129479
spent
true